Ruby on rails documentation pdf download free

Newly updated for rails 6, the ruby on rails tutorial book and screencast series teach you how to develop and deploy real, industrialstrength web applications with ruby on rails, the opensource web framework that powers top websites such as github, hulu, shopify, and airbnb. Ruby on rails pdf tutorial learn the basics of ruby on rails programming language, free training document in 250 pages for all level users. We are installing ruby on rails on linux using rbenv. The ruby ruby documentation project is an effort by the ruby community to provide complete and accurate documentation for the ruby programming language. More than 5,000 people already have contributed code to rails. And a variety of opensource gems enable developers to implement rich functionality in. Free ebook ruby on rails security from ruby on rails security project.

Ruby on rails creating a ruby on rails 5 api rubyon. The last security guide for rails was a great success, with a lot of more secure web applications and continued awareness in the community of security issues. Our ruby on rails tutorial includes all topics of ruby on rails such as features, mvc, router, scaffolding, views, hello world example, bundlers, migrations, layout, crud example, interview questions etc. There are different ways that this can be achieved in. There are different ways that this can be achieved in rails. The ruby source is available from a worldwide set of mirror sites.

Information about the current maintenance status of the various ruby branches can be found on the branches page. Please note, that some gems are not yet compatible with ruby2. Free ruby books download ebooks online textbooks tutorials. The best approach for generating pdfs in rails really depends on the types of pdfs you need to generate. All you need to do is download the training document, open it and start learning ruby for free. The rbenv provides an easy installation procedure to manage various versions of ruby, and a solid environment for developing ruby on rails applications. The ruby on rails security project is the one and only source of information about rails security topics. Text content is released under creative commons bysa. Pdf writer is designed to provide a pure ruby way to dynamically create pdf documents.

Easily find and browse ruby classes, modules and methods. This course is adapted to your level as well as all ruby pdf courses to better enrich your knowledge. Please note, that some gems are not yet compatible with ruby 2. The ruby documentation project is an effort by the ruby community to provide complete and accurate documentation for the ruby programming language. Ruby on rails provides a web development framework that makes it easy to create websites with ruby. By gregory brown 328 pages ruby best practices is for programmers who want to use ruby as experienced rubyists do. Ruby, rails and rspec documentation with users notes. Ruby on rails is open source software, so not only is it free to use, you can also help make it better. The onestop web site for reference documentation about ruby gems and githubhosted ruby projects. Ruby on rails, also known as ror or rails, uses the model view controller mvc architecture and allows you to develop applications by writing less code language. If for whatever reason you spot something to fix but cannot patch it yourself, please open an issue. Aws provides the awssdk rails gem to enable easy integration with rails. Manual reference the big ebook you must read is rails antipatternsbestpractice ruby on rails lq460302020. It runs on a variety of platforms, such as windows, mac os, and the various versions of unix.

One of the interesting challenges, among many, stemmed from the fact that the project had large sections of readable content. You can use aws elastic beanstalk, aws opsworks, aws codedeploy, or the aws rails provisioner to deploy and run your rails applications in the aws cloud. Obviously, this will not be as fast as one that uses a compiled extension, but it is surprisingly fast. Apr 17, 2020 wicked pdf a pdf generation plugin for ruby on rails. This book is currently broken down into several sections and is intended to be read sequentially. What is implemented and what is not this application extends the railsdeviseroles example application, showing how to provide a pdf file download when a visitor registers for an account. Download ruby on rails web mashup projects free epub, mobi, pdf ebooks download, ebook torrents download. We worked with the bill of rights institute recently to create an interactive digital course for american history teachers. This may contain bugs or other issues, use at your own risk. I am sure like the rails antipatternsbestpractice ruby on rails lq460302020. Ruby on rails tutorial learn enough to be dangerous. The ruby core and standard library documentation is part of the installation. Ruby on rails a webapplication framework that includes. This document was created with prince, a great way of getting web content onto paper.

Oct 21, 2016 if youre new to rails, see what is ruby on rails. And last but not least, any kind of discussion regarding ruby on rails documentation is very welcome on the rubyonrails docs mailing list. Rails is a web application development framework written in the ruby programming language. Substantial changes were introduced in each major version of the framework, starting with a serious rewrite in rails 3, so learning with obsolete. Ruby free pdf book rails 3 in action ruby book free download. Wh i l e sh o e s i s b a s e d on t h e s t a n d a rd r u b y i n t e rp r e t e r an d. All you need to do is download the training document, open it.

Study ruby programming with free opensource books oss blog.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Since 1995, its popularity in japan has grown at an astounding rate. Mar 24, 2014 the ability to download data in pdf format is a common requirement that you will encounter when building web applications. Check the ruby on rails guides guidelines for style and conventions. And last but not least, any kind of discussion regarding ruby on rails documentation is very welcome on the rubyonrailsdocs mailing list. While a lot of great ruby on rails books out there target rails 2, 3, 4, and 5, do not make the mistake of buying an obsolete rails book if you intend to develop with version 6. Aws provides the awssdkrails gem to enable easy integration with rails. To create a new rails 5 api, open a terminal and run the following command.

In other words, rather than dealing with a pdf generation dsl of some sort, you simply write an html view as you would normally, then let wicked pdf take care of the hard stuff. And last but not least, any kind of discussion regarding ruby on rails documentation is very welcome in the rubyonrailsdocs mailing list. Before you deploy a ruby on rails application, read the ruby on rails documentation. Note that this is the 1st edition of michael hartls ruby on rails 3 tutorial. The ruby on rails tutorial book is available for purchase as an ebook pdf, epub, and mobi formats. Ruby on rails pdf tutorial computer tutorials in pdf. Nov 28, 2018 the best approach for generating pdfs in rails really depends on the types of pdfs you need to generate. Ruby was created by yukihiro matsumoto matz in japan.

Ruby software free download ruby top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Hello, this is wojtek reporting on last month additions to rails codebase. We also recommend the online documentation or html version downloadable from ruby. Follow the steps given below to install ruby on rails using rbenv tool. This tutorial gives a complete understanding on ruby. This tutorial will provide stepbystep instructions for generating pdfs by using wkhtmltopdf, an open source cli for rendering html into pdf from standard rails view and style code. It is designed to make programming web applications easier by making assumptions about what every developer needs to get started. Optimizing for programmer happiness with convention over configuration is how we roll. Take advantage of this course called ruby on rails pdf tutorial to improve your web development skills and better understand ruby. Ruby on rails is a serverside web application development framework. Learn rails by example addisonwesley professional ruby series overall, ruby on rails 3 tutorial is one of the best programming tutorial books.

Ruby on rails web mashup projects free ebooks download. The ruby on rails not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. Download sitepoints entire ruby on rails book free. Ruby on rails is a development environment for the creation of web applications with databases in ruby programming language. Ruby is a scripting language designed by yukihiro matsumoto, also known as matz. Notation conventions, basic ruby, ruby semantic reference, built in classes, standard library. Wicked pdf a pdf generation plugin for ruby on rails.

From installing ruby, rails and mysql, to building and deploying a fully featured web application, this book has it all. This manual is, in some ways, a worst case scenario because of the number of examples that must. Wicked pdf uses the shell utility wkhtmltopdf to serve a pdf file to a user from html. But to date, much of the detailed ruby documentation is in japanese. Pdfwriter is designed to provide a pure ruby way to dynamically create pdf documents. It probably isnt a programming language youd just stumble across.

Written by the developer of the ruby project prawn, this book explains how to design beautiful apis and domainspecific languages with ruby, as well as how to work with functional programming ideas and techniques that can simplify your code. Actual documentation belongs to the respective authors, who deserve your recognition and praise. Ruby on rails, also known as ror or rails, uses the model view controller mvc architecture and. For information about the ruby subversion and git repositories, see our ruby core page. Ruby on rails rails is a web application development framework written in the ruby programming language. The ability to download data in pdf format is a common requirement that you will encounter when building web applications. Moreover, ruby on rails is an opensource framework that means investors pay nothing at all for using it. Railsantipatternsbestpracticerubyonrailslq460302020.

445 1510 424 458 1058 535 735 1452 50 953 1489 1460 1096 1120 44 744 1070 333 800 170 1402 1321 856 716 948 372 796 343 881 1259 478 68 746 996 1475 1113 878 598 939 275 1037 793 1264 527 153 1298